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Programmieren allgemein (https://www.delphipraxis.net/40-programmieren-allgemein/)
-   -   Programm-Icon wird in der EXE-Datei nicht mehr angezeigt (https://www.delphipraxis.net/174132-programm-icon-wird-der-exe-datei-nicht-mehr-angezeigt.html)

HPB 5. Apr 2013 17:25

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Guten Tag Delphianer,
folgendes Problem:
Ich füge meinem Programm unter "Projekt - Optionen - Anwendung" ein Symbol hinzu. Siehe Bild1.
Nachdem Compilieren erwarte ich natürlich, dass das Icon auch im Exe-Namen mit angezeigt wird. War ja bisher immerso!
Stattdessen finde ich ein (X). Siehe Bild2. Ist natürlich nicht so toll, wenn ich das Produckt
dem Kunden übergebe. Bisher wurde auch immer das richtige ICON angezeigt.
Beim Programmaufruf wird das richtige Icon in das Taskbar angezeigt.
Bei meinen anderen Projekten wird das richtige, zugewiesene Icon angezeigt.
Was ich bisher getan und im Forum gefunden habe:
Ich habe per Batch-Datei den ICON-Cache von Windows gelöscht.
Die Exe-Datei gelöscht.
Das Programm unter Projekt - Alle Projekte neu erzeugen - neu erzeugen lassen.
Es führte aber nichts zum Erfolg.
Was kann ich noch tun, damit das Icon wieder im EXE-Name angeziegt wird.
Mit Gruß HPB

Union 5. Apr 2013 17:39

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Schau Dir mal die Icon-Datei mit einem geeigneten Programm an. Diese kann nämlich unterschiedliche Grafiken für verschiedene Auflösungen enthalten. Das, was Du in den Projektoptionen siehst, muss nicht immer dem entsprechen was dann tatsächlich angezeigt wird.

Perlsau 5. Apr 2013 18:13

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Zitat:

Zitat von Union (Beitrag 1210201)
Schau Dir mal die Icon-Datei mit einem geeigneten Programm an. Diese kann nämlich unterschiedliche Grafiken für verschiedene Auflösungen enthalten. Das, was Du in den Projektoptionen siehst, muss nicht immer dem entsprechen was dann tatsächlich angezeigt wird.

Genau: Wenn da ein X angezeigt wird, muß dieses X ja auch irgendwo im Icon existieren.

@ HPB: Greenfish, ein kostenloser Icon-Editor, zeigt dir alle existierenden Seiten eines Icons an.

HPB 5. Apr 2013 18:19

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Zitat:

Zitat von Perlsau (Beitrag 1210207)
Zitat:

Zitat von Union (Beitrag 1210201)
Schau Dir mal die Icon-Datei mit einem geeigneten Programm an. Diese kann nämlich unterschiedliche Grafiken für verschiedene Auflösungen enthalten. Das, was Du in den Projektoptionen siehst, muss nicht immer dem entsprechen was dann tatsächlich angezeigt wird.

Genau: Wenn da ein X angezeigt wird, muß dieses X ja auch irgendwo im Icon existieren.

@ HPB: Greenfish, ein kostenloser Icon-Editor, zeigt dir alle existierenden Seiten eines Icons an.

Ich habe die Icon-Datei mit IcoFX angesehen. Da ist kein "X" enthalten.
Ich habe mal der Anwendung ein neues, anderes Icon zugewiesen.
Ergebnis: Auch diese Icon wird nicht angezeigt, sondern es bleibt beim "X".
Mit Gruß
HPB

Union 5. Apr 2013 18:22

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Du scheinst Die Datei mit igendeinem "Commander" anzusehen. Hast Du es mal mit dem normalen Explorer versucht? Was passiert wenn Du eine Verknüpfung auf den Desktop erstellst oder das Programm startest - Was für ein Icon wird dann angezeigt?

Perlsau 5. Apr 2013 18:55

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Zitat:

Zitat von HPB (Beitrag 1210208)
Ich habe die Icon-Datei mit IcoFX angesehen. Da ist kein "X" enthalten. Ich habe mal der Anwendung ein neues, anderes Icon zugewiesen. Ergebnis: Auch diese Icon wird nicht angezeigt, sondern es bleibt beim "X".

Könnte es sein, daß das Programm, mit dem du den Ordner mit der Exe-Datei listest, mit dem Icon irgendwelche Probleme hat? Vielleicht sucht dieser Commander ja nach einer Seite im Icon, die gar nicht existiert? Soweit ich weiß, benötigt man für ein mehrseitiges Icon, das in allen Fällen korrekt angezeigt wird, mindestens drei Icon-Seitenlängen: 256, 128 und 64. Manche älteren Commander erwarten da aber vielleicht eine Seitenlänge von 32, und wenn die fehlt, stellen sie das Icon mit einem eigenen Ersatz-Icon dar.

haentschman 6. Apr 2013 09:58

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Moin... 8-)

Kannn es sein, daß du mit TMS arbeitest ? Dann wäre evt. das:
http://www.tmssoftware.com/site/foru...-program-icons interessant.

HPB 6. Apr 2013 10:14

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Zitat:

Zitat von haentschman (Beitrag 1210249)
Moin... 8-)

Kannn es sein, daß du mit TMS arbeitest ? Dann wäre evt. das:
http://www.tmssoftware.com/site/foru...-program-icons interessant.

Ja, ich arbeite mit den TMS-Componenten.
Vielen Dank für den Hinweis. Muss ich mal testen.
Mit Gruß HPB

HPB 6. Apr 2013 14:01

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
Zitat:

Zitat von HPB (Beitrag 1210254)
Zitat:

Zitat von haentschman (Beitrag 1210249)
Moin... 8-)

Kannn es sein, daß du mit TMS arbeitest ? Dann wäre evt. das:
http://www.tmssoftware.com/site/foru...-program-icons interessant.

Ja, ich arbeite mit den TMS-Componenten.
Vielen Dank für den Hinweis. Muss ich mal testen.
Mit Gruß HPB


----
Vielen Dank an haentschman. Es hat am TMS-Componenten-Pack gelegen.
In der jetzigen Version 8.0.0.1 ist der Fehler von TMS wieder behoben.
Das Thema kann geschlossen werden.
Mit Gruß HPB

haentschman 6. Apr 2013 15:56

AW: Programm-Icon wird in der EXE-Datei nicht mehr angezeigt
 
... gern geschehen. War eigentlich mehr durch Zufall drübergestolpert. 8-)


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:47 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z